The Cost of Crisis: As disasters become more frequent and expensive, the need to update US disaster policy grows

2020 saw the US hit by a record 22 climate and weather disasters which caused losses greater than a billion dollars.

Shaking The Foundations: Japan continues to increase spending to ensure infrastructure can handle natural disasters

In December, the government announced a new five year plan investing over $140 billion to mitigate disaster risks.

Industry Pulse

Agility has announced the acquisition of Connecticut-based RecoveryPlanner, a long established provider of business continuity software and consultancy services. RecoveryPlanner CEO Monica Goldstein, JD, CBCP, joins the Agility team as well as RecoveryPlanner’s certified Business Continuity Planners and Support groups.

“We have seen an increased demand for business continuity planning assistance as companies rethink and elevate their overall risk management,” said Jon Bahl, CEO of Agility Recovery. “RecoveryPlanner has industry expertise and credibility working with clients to manage risk and incidents, including complex, robust business continuity planning, which meshes perfectly with our simple, lighter approach through Agility Planner. In keeping with our mission, we now offer end-to-end business continuity planning for businesses, no matter how simple or complex their program requirements.”

In addition to tools for business continuity planning, incident management, and integrated risk management, the RecoveryPlanner team includes master-certified business continuity planners and industry experts who join the Agility team.

The acquisition of RecoveryPlanner strengthens the Agility SaaS offering and brand previously elevated through the acquisitions of Recovery Solutions in 2020, Preparis emergency notification software in 2019, and Rentsys Recovery Services in 2018.
